Benefits Specialist (life, annuities and individual insurance)
Benefits Specialist (life, annuities and individual insurance)
Preparedness is key and our Benefits Specialists help our clients navigate the insurance options available to them in order to protect what’s most important in their lives. The Koch Co. is seeking an ambitious go-getter who enjoys working with and helping our clients and team members.
What’s the work like?
You will:
- effectively and independently manage customer service accountabilities on a book of business comprised of individual and group benefit plans
- assist producer in development of service plan for assigned accounts; and coordinate and monitor the service plan as needed
- responsible for file setup and quotes for individuals and groups
- assist producers in preparation of enrollment materials and presentations and attend client meetings and benefit fairs
- complete servicing of accounts, including but not limited to utilizing standard proposals, spreadsheets and Power Point presentations, depending upon which product is quoted
- promptly invoice all premium-bearing transactions
- review policies upon receipt in accordance with agency procedures for timely customer service
- review all applications and policies for accuracy and completeness and take an active role in completing all carrier requirements to implement policy
- manage renewal process according to agency procedures; review quotes, prepare proposals
- promptly respond to customers’ questions and/or requests for assistance
- communicate all necessary information to producers, clients, carriers and any other agency team members servicing the account
- maintain the electronic account file and fully incorporate the capabilities of the agency management system into daily workflow
- perform quality reviews as requested by management, and comply with requirements of quality programs
- maintain effective working relationships with clients to support business retention and accompany producer to client and carrier meetings as necessary
- ensure confidentiality is maintained in the collection, maintenance, and dissemination of highly sensitive information, including Protected Health Information (PHI)
What do I need to know?
You have to have…
- a Nebraska Life, Sickness, Accident and Health Agent’s license
- a professional designation of RHU or equivalent or willingness to pursue
- a High School diploma or equivalent
- minimum of three (3) years in Employee Benefits experience
- previous experience with life, annuities and disability insurance
- a valid Driver’s License
- knowledge of COBRA, HIPAA, FMLA, Medicare, self-funded groups and 5500’s
- excellent verbal and written communication skills.
- strong organizational skills and ability to multi-task
- high degree of proficiency in Microsoft Office products (Word, Excel), electronic mail system, and all other agency automation software
- strong respect for confidentiality
- ability to establish and maintain effective working relationships with company employees and external contacts
